GLI1和Shh在卵巢子宫内膜异位症恶变中的表达及意义

[Expression and significance of GLI1 and Shh in the malignant transformation of ovarian endometriosis].

Abstract

To investigate the expression levels and clinical significance of glioma-associated oncogene homolog 1 (GLI1) and sonic hedgehog signaling molecule (Shh) in the malignant transformation of ovarian endometriosis (EM). The expressions of GLI1 and Shh were detected by real-time reverse transcription (RT)-polymerase chain reaction (PCR) and EnVision method in 50 cases of ovarian EM tissues, 35 cases of atypical endometriosis (aEM) and 50 cases of endometriosis-associated ovarian cancer (EAOC). The expression differences of two molecular markers in the malignant transformation of ovarian EM were compared, and the relationships between two molecular markers and the clinicopathological features and prognosis of EAOC were analyzed. (1) RT-PCR showed that the expression levels of GLI1 mRNA in EM, aEM and EAOC group were 1.77±0.40, 3.54±0.44, and 7.80±0.24, respectively. The expression levels of Shh mRNA were 0.95±0.21, 3.14±0.35, and 5.41±0.31, respectively. GLI1 and Shh mRNA in EAOC group were significantly higher than those in EM and aEM group (all <0.01), and there were statistically significant differences between EM and aEM group (all <0.01). The percentages of GLI1 in ovarian EM, aEM and EAOC were 32% (16/50), 57% (20/35), and 66% (33/50), respectively, meanwhile, the positive expression rates of Shh were 20% (10/50), 49% (17/35), and 54% (27/50), respectively (all <0.01). GLI1 mRNA expression was positively correlated with Shh mRNA expression in EAOC tissues (=0.721, <0.01). The expressions of GLI1 protein were proportionated to Shh protein in EAOC tissues (=0.608,=0.001). (2) The expression of GLI1 was significantly related to the International Federation of Gynecology and Obstetrics (FIGO) stage, cancer antigen 125 (CA) levels, lymph node metastasis, and Platinum resistance in EAOC patients (all <0.05). The expression of Shh were related to FIGO stage and lymph node metastasis in EAOC patients (all <0.05). Logistic regression analysis showed that GLI1 expression was an independent risk factor for poor prognosis in EAOC patients (<0.05). Kaplan-meier survival analysis showed that the overall survival rate of EAOC patients with high GLI1 expression and low GLI1 expression was 12.1% and 35.3%, respectively, with statistical significance (²=10.73, <0.01). The overall survival rate of EAOC patients with high and low expression of Shh protein was 11.1% and 30.4%, in which there was statistically significant difference (²=3.96, =0.047). GLI1 and Shh are highly associated with the malignant transformation of ovarian EM, which may play a role in promoting malignant degeneration of ovarian EM, and the high expression of GLI1 and Shh indicates a poor prognosis in EAOC patients.

摘要

探讨胶质瘤相关癌基因同源物1(GLI1)和音猬因子信号分子(Shh)在卵巢子宫内膜异位症(EM)恶变中的表达水平及临床意义。采用实时逆转录(RT)-聚合酶链反应(PCR)和EnVision法检测50例卵巢EM组织、35例不典型子宫内膜异位症(aEM)及50例子宫内膜异位症相关卵巢癌(EAOC)中GLI1和Shh的表达。比较两种分子标志物在卵巢EM恶变中的表达差异,并分析其与EAOC临床病理特征及预后的关系。(1)RT-PCR结果显示,EM组、aEM组及EAOC组GLI1 mRNA表达水平分别为1.77±0.40、3.54±0.44及7.80±0.24。Shh mRNA表达水平分别为0.95±0.21、3.14±0.35及5.41±0.31。EAOC组GLI1和Shh mRNA表达均显著高于EM组及aEM组(均P<0.01),EM组与aEM组比较差异也有统计学意义(均P<0.01)。卵巢EM、aEM及EAOC中GLI1阳性率分别为32%(16/50)、57%(20/35)及66%(33/50),Shh阳性表达率分别为20%(10/50)、49%(17/35)及54%(27/50)(均P<0.01)。EAOC组织中GLI1 mRNA表达与Shh mRNA表达呈正相关(r=0.721,P<0.01)。EAOC组织中GLI1蛋白表达与Shh蛋白表达成比例(r=0.608,P=0.001)。(2)EAOC患者中GLI1表达与国际妇产科联盟(FIGO)分期、癌抗原125(CA)水平、淋巴结转移及铂耐药均显著相关(均P<0.05)。Shh表达与EAOC患者FIGO分期及淋巴结转移相关(均P<0.05)。Logistic回归分析显示,GLI1表达是EAOC患者预后不良的独立危险因素(P<0.05)。Kaplan-Meier生存分析显示,GLI1高表达与低表达的EAOC患者总生存率分别为12.1%和35.3%,差异有统计学意义(χ²=10.73,P<0.01)。Shh蛋白高表达与低表达的EAOC患者总生存率分别为11.1%和30.4%,差异有统计学意义(χ²=3.96,P=0.047)。GLI1和Shh与卵巢EM恶变高度相关,可能在促进卵巢EM恶变中起作用,且GLI1和Shh高表达提示EAOC患者预后不良。
